[edk2-devel] [Patch V2][edk2-stable201908] BaseTools: Incorrect error message for library instance not found

Bob Feng bob.c.feng at intel.com
Thu Aug 22 04:00:46 UTC 2019


BZ:https://bugzilla.tianocore.org/show_bug.cgi?id=2099
This is a regression issue introduced by commit e8449e.

This patch is to fix this issue.

Signed-off-by: Bob Feng <bob.c.feng at intel.com>
Cc: Liming Gao <liming.gao at intel.com>
---
V2: We need to check if a inf is a Library or a Module.
 BaseTools/Source/Python/AutoGen/DataPipe.py         |  2 +-
 BaseTools/Source/Python/AutoGen/PlatformAutoGen.py  |  2 +-
 BaseTools/Source/Python/AutoGen/WorkspaceAutoGen.py |  4 +++-
 .../Source/Python/Workspace/WorkspaceCommon.py      | 13 +++++++------
 4 files changed, 12 insertions(+), 9 deletions(-)
